		<description>Rav Felder was a big posek in Toronto.  His son, Rav Aaron Felder, is a posek and a Rav in Philadelphia.  One other son is a Rav in Toronto at the shul where Rav Felder was Rav and another lives in Baltimore.</description>

		<description>His mother (Esther Lifsha) was a daughter of Rav Gedalia Schorr. Her brother was R&#039; Avrohom Schorr, father of Rav Gedalia (R&quot;Y Torah Vodas &amp; BME) and Rav Yakov (Nesivos Olam/Malochim).

Behind him is his aunt Mrs. Miriam Seifer. She passed away at the age of 99/100. Unfortunately, she never had children. She helped to raise him and his sister after their mother passed away in 1924/25.</description>
